My first interview was with a recruiter, and it was a very positive experience. He was personable, informative, and took the time to thoroughly explain the role, company culture, and expectations for the position. He made the conversation feel comfortable and engaging, which helped create a great first impression of the company.
My second interview was with a team manager and focused more on my background, experience, and how I would fit within the team. The questions were fairly standard interview questions, covering topics such as previous experience, strengths, problem-solving, and handling different workplace situations. Overall, the interview process was professional, well organized, and gave me a better understanding of the opportunity and team dynamics.
